Exclusion zone
There is a required exclusion zone, or minimum of clear space, around the SAS logo, equal to the height of the S-mark. No other logo or images are allowed in this area.

Confirm that you have the most recent version of the SAS logo, with appropriate trademark symbols. Incorporate the correct use of the in the logo and the tagline. Choose the appropriate logo for the background color on which it appears.
Designers should choose a logo color combination that is appropriate for the background color on which it is placed. The colors in the S-mark should blend into the background color when possible. Solid-colored versions of the S-mark are acceptable alternatives when blending the gradient colors into the background color is not possible. Designers must honor the exclusion zone of clear space around the logo. The SAS logo may not appear in headlines or text. The SAS logo may not be combined with any art or text other than that approved by Corporate Communications Global, such as the logo-with-tagline combination or SAS logo and address treatments. The S-mark and the SAS word mark may not be separated. The SAS logo may not be encompassed within another shape. Use the logo in the title of a magazine masthead, brochure, or newsletter. Use the logo in headlines or body text. Incorporate the SAS logo with another logo. Enhance the logo, superimpose it, or alter it in any way. Encompass the logo within another shape. Use the logo in advertising, marketing materials or collateral without clear identification of SAS legal ownership by including this language: SAS is a registered trademark of SAS Institute Inc., Cary, North Carolina, USA. Separate the S-mark from the sas word mark.
